How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Walnut Creek?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Walnut Creek Studio Apartments | $1,155 | $779 | $2,034 |
Walnut Creek 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,259 | $632 | $3,093 |
Walnut Creek 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,645 | $752 | $4,763 |
Walnut Creek 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,017 | $725 | $3,293 |
Walnut Creek 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,330 | $1,651 | $2,884 |

Getting Around the Walnut Creek Neighborhood in Austin, TX
Walk Score®
29 / 100
Car-Dependent
Most errands require a car
Bike Score®
36 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
24 / 100
Minimal Transit
It may be possible to get on a bus
